COLUMBIA, — A multi-agency pursuit that began in Camden on Tuesday afternoon ended with a suspect in custody after a high-speed chase that spanned multiple jurisdictions and reached speeds exceeding 100 mph.
According to initial reports, the incident began at approximately 2:37 p.m. when officers attempted a traffic stop on a gray Toyota Camry in Camden. The driver, who was reportedly wanted on outstanding warrants, failed to stop and fled the scene, prompting a pursuit.
Law enforcement agencies involved included Kershaw County deputies, Elgin Police, Richland County authorities, and the South Carolina Highway Patrol…
